    I have access to all 4.

    With respect to sound quality, there's zero difference (assuming a 100%/WI rip). With respect to overall polish of the upload, proper names and tags, a nice description, full artwork scans, etc, that's what you'll find at Pedro's/E. That being said, they also have a fraction of the torrents available on What/Waffles, which in turn have a fraction of the torrents on Demonoid/Rutracker.

    Also it's worth noting that a sub 100%/non-WI rip will still generally sound fine, and unless it's got a ton of skips/suspicious positions it will be undoubtedly better than an MP3 rip. The big difference is it's no longer a 1:1 perfect copy of the original CD.
